Fowlers Hollow State Park
About this site
Fowlers Hollow State Park is a small, intimate 18-site campground nestled in a narrow valley carved by Fowler Hollow Run within Tuscarora State Forest near Newville, Pennsylvania. The campground offers 12 electric hookup sites and 6 walk-in tent sites, all backing up to the stream. Sites range from $20-$40 per night depending on type. The park features clean restrooms, picnic tables, and a sanitary dump station. Amenities include electric, water, and sewer hookups, with 30 and 50 amp service available. The campground is popular with hikers and anglers seeking a quiet, secluded retreat. Several walking and hiking trails start directly from the campground. Note: There are no shower facilities. Arrive during daylight hours for easier site navigation.
